Authorities accused Ryan Mosqueda of shooting at Border Patrol agents and local police arriving at an annex facility in Texas while armed with a rifle and tactical gear. Two officers and a Border Patrol employee were injured — including one shot in the knee — and transported to the hospital, according to a Department of Homeland Security (DHS) spokesperson. Law enforcement shot and killed the suspect on the scene. (Sign up for Mary Rooke’s weekly newsletter here!)

Authorities believe the shooting was an intentional attack on border officials, according to Fox News.
